I spent the last 2 days trying to get past this encounter in this weeks Guild Expedition. I have a 120% Attack and 90% Defense boost going against an enemy with only 75% Attack and Defense boost. I tried several different troop combinations and even tried negotiating several times. I lost every troop I had and still somehow was not able to beat it. Even if I lost only 1 troop in the first wave, when the 2nd wave came around, the enemy units were able to kill most of my troops with FULL health before I was even given a chance to move. This does not make sense given my %'s were far higher than theirs. Last week I had no problem passing 48.

What's the trick to beating this fight?

Well, personally just to make sure you should try 2 units with 6 rogues. This way, even if you lose one of them, you still have another for round two.

But here I would take a different approach. I would use 2 Rockets and 6 Rogues. I would do this.
On Wave 1, you should get rushed. I would not panic, as you need them to turn your rogues for you. Once it is your Turn, I would take out their Rockets, UNLESS they already went. If they already have GONE, I would take out the troops rushing you. I would move around and try to stay out of their range. But this is trial and error for you. The rockets are pretty deadly in this case, so make sure you hit what's coming at you, UNLESS you have troops NOT turned. If you have troops NOT turned, I would move them up one or two squares to entice a hit. YES, you can bait them into hitting you. That's the trick in taking away a hit from them. Remember the rogues are key, as they absorb the hits for you.

Ok, Wave 2: Does not matter what you have left, as long as you have 1 Rocket and 5 rogues you can still win easily.
The rockets are good against the tanks (they have a bonus against them), so do this.
The game will probably alternate your rockets to rockets, as they are the same units. Meaning they will go, then you go.
How I use to and still do is NOT hit the first one that goes for them, BUT the second one. This way, I get a second shot in on them and POOF, they are gone. So, let the first one hit you and it should turn a rogue for you. Then you just pick off the Rockets and Heavy's coming your way, while you back up and stick to the corners. That's an easy winner for you, honestly. Try that and you will get the hang of fighting with the Rockets, they are pretty nice and good in PME Age.
